Title An earnest exhortation to a true Ninivitish repentance. : VVherein is briefly declared: 1. What true repentance is. 2. How a man should perceive it wrought in him. 3. Exhortation to a due examination of everie ones self. 4. A right penitentiall prayer. 5. The barres which hinder Christs working in the soul. 6. What true and living faith is. Also two questions resolved: 1. From whence warre doth spring. 2. By what means it ends. Together with other considerable matter fit for the times.
Publication Info London : Printed by T.P. and M.S. and are to be sold by Ben. Allen in Popes Head Alley, 1643. [i.e. 1642]



Descript [2], 24 p.
Note Thomason received his copy on 26 December 1642.
Annotation on Thomason copy: "Decemb: 26".
Reproduction of the original in the British Library.
